Commits on Dec 28, 2021

  1. (maint) Pin async gem

    Async 2.0.0 uses Ruby 3, so we're pinning to 1.x
    Christopher Thorn committed Dec 28, 2021
    Configuration menu
    Copy the full SHA
    783c17e View commit details
    Browse the repository at this point in the history
  2. Merge pull request #32 from cthorn42/maint/main/pin_async_gem

    (maint) Pin async gem
    mhashizume authored Dec 28, 2021
    Configuration menu
    Copy the full SHA
    881c471 View commit details
    Browse the repository at this point in the history

Commits on Jan 11, 2022

  1. (maint) Github workflow now uses windows 2019

    Upgraded github actions to use windows 2019 instead of windows 2016 as
    it will be removed on March 15, 2022.
    Dorin-Pleava committed Jan 11, 2022
    Configuration menu
    Copy the full SHA
    45ba42a View commit details
    Browse the repository at this point in the history

Commits on Jan 13, 2022

  1. Merge pull request #33 from Dorin-Pleava/PUP-11370/github_actions_upg…

    …rade_windows
    
    (maint) Github workflow now uses windows 2019
    GabrielNagy authored Jan 13, 2022
    Configuration menu
    Copy the full SHA
    bca7932 View commit details
    Browse the repository at this point in the history

Commits on Jan 22, 2022

  1. Configuration menu
    Copy the full SHA
    9aeba8d View commit details
    Browse the repository at this point in the history

Commits on Jan 25, 2022

  1. Merge pull request #34 from AriaXLi/PA-4133

    (PA-4133) Add phoenix to CODEOWNERS
    mhashizume authored Jan 25, 2022
    Configuration menu
    Copy the full SHA
    050b2f8 View commit details
    Browse the repository at this point in the history

Commits on Feb 15, 2022

  1. Configuration menu
    Copy the full SHA
    1a596e3 View commit details
    Browse the repository at this point in the history
  2. Merge pull request #35 from AriaXLi/nightly_puppet_gem_curl_redirect

    (maint) Add redirect to nightly puppet gem download
    cthorn42 authored Feb 15, 2022
    Configuration menu
    Copy the full SHA
    2522f57 View commit details
    Browse the repository at this point in the history

Commits on Feb 16, 2022

  1. Configuration menu
    Copy the full SHA
    7f5a1d7 View commit details
    Browse the repository at this point in the history
  2. Merge pull request #36 from AriaXLi/nightly_puppet_gem_curl_redirect

    (MODULES-11283) update curl command for installing the latest nightly…
    mhashizume authored Feb 16, 2022
    Configuration menu
    Copy the full SHA
    0008c75 View commit details
    Browse the repository at this point in the history

Commits on Mar 21, 2022

  1. (maint) Add Solaris patch to testing

    Christopher Thorn committed Mar 21, 2022
    Configuration menu
    Copy the full SHA
    f0c7d78 View commit details
    Browse the repository at this point in the history
  2. Merge pull request #37 from cthorn42/maint/main/PA-4333_fix_install_m…

    …ethod_for_solaris
    
    (PA-4333) Add Solaris patch to testing
    mhashizume authored Mar 21, 2022
    Configuration menu
    Copy the full SHA
    e352e7e View commit details
    Browse the repository at this point in the history

Commits on Oct 6, 2022

  1. Configuration menu
    Copy the full SHA
    ad9e1ea View commit details
    Browse the repository at this point in the history
  2. (MODULES-11349) Update macOS GitHub Action runner

    GitHub Actions' macOS 10.15 runners are going end-of-life on
    December 1, 2022:
    actions/runner-images#5583
    
    This commit updates the macOS runners in use to macos-latest,
    which is currently macOS 11 Big Sur.
    mhashizume committed Oct 6, 2022
    Configuration menu
    Copy the full SHA
    7165b15 View commit details
    Browse the repository at this point in the history

Commits on Oct 17, 2022

  1. Merge pull request #38 from mhashizume/PA-4691/main/macos_gha

    (MODULES-11349) Updates macOS GitHub Actions runners
    cthorn42 authored Oct 17, 2022
    Configuration menu
    Copy the full SHA
    6759abf View commit details
    Browse the repository at this point in the history

Commits on Feb 10, 2023

  1. (MODULES-11371) Updates PDK template

    This commit runs `pdk update` using the most recent template at the
    time (2.7.1) and updates metadata.json to allow Puppet versions
    < 9.0.0 in preparation for the release of Puppet 8.
    mhashizume committed Feb 10, 2023
    Configuration menu
    Copy the full SHA
    742031c View commit details
    Browse the repository at this point in the history
  2. (MODULES-11376) Update GitHub Action Ubuntu runner

    GitHub is deprecating Ubuntu 18.04 runners on April 1, 2023. This
    commit switches all Ubuntu 18.04 runners used in GitHub Actions to
    Ubuntu 20.04.
    
    https://github.blog/changelog/2022-08-09-github-actions-the-ubuntu-18-04-actions-runner-image-is-being-deprecated-and-will-be-removed-by-12-1-22/
    
    This commit also updates all instances of the actions/checkout@v2
    to actions/checkout@v3 in perparation for the former's deprecation
    as part of the NodeJS deprecation.
    
    https://github.blog/changelog/2022-09-22-github-actions-all-actions-will-begin-running-on-node16-instead-of-node12/
    mhashizume committed Feb 10, 2023
    Configuration menu
    Copy the full SHA
    8c5b673 View commit details
    Browse the repository at this point in the history

Commits on Feb 14, 2023

  1. (MODULES-11371) Change auto release Docker image

    The PDK Docker image does not contain any build tools, which causes
    the installation of gems that use native extensions to fail.
    
    This commit changes the Docker image used in the Auto Release
    GitHub Action from the PDK image to the Puppet dev-tools image,
    which contains packages like `make` necessary for building native
    extensions.
    mhashizume committed Feb 14, 2023
    Configuration menu
    Copy the full SHA
    a8f61e8 View commit details
    Browse the repository at this point in the history
  2. (MODULES-11371) Add Vox Beaker gem

    In 742031c, we updated the module according to PDK template 7.2.1,
    which updated puppetlabs_spec_helper. The updated version of
    puppetlabs_spec_helper removed the Beaker rake task, which we use
    for acceptance testing.
    
    This commit adds the voxpupuli-acceptance gem, which re-adds the
    Beaker rake task.
    mhashizume committed Feb 14, 2023
    Configuration menu
    Copy the full SHA
    03d3626 View commit details
    Browse the repository at this point in the history
  3. (MODULES-11371) Pin gems for auto release

    Modeling after the learnings of the support team in commit
    puppetlabs/puppetlabs-puppet_metrics_collector@78dd858
    
    This commit pins the github_changelog_generator gem to its latest
    version to make it work, and the concurrent-ruby to an older version
    to compensate for the version of PDK shipped in the dev-tools
    container image.
    mhashizume committed Feb 14, 2023
    Configuration menu
    Copy the full SHA
    dfd4030 View commit details
    Browse the repository at this point in the history
  4. Merge pull request #39 from mhashizume/MODULES-11371/main/puppet-8-prep

    (MODULES-11371) Updates PDK template
    joshcooper authored Feb 14, 2023
    Configuration menu
    Copy the full SHA
    ed7bfd9 View commit details
    Browse the repository at this point in the history
  5. Release prep v1.2.0

    GitHub Action committed Feb 14, 2023
    Configuration menu
    Copy the full SHA
    c3a5df4 View commit details
    Browse the repository at this point in the history
  6. Merge pull request #40 from puppetlabs/release-prep

    Release prep v1.2.0
    mhashizume authored Feb 14, 2023
    Configuration menu
    Copy the full SHA
    d6b6393 View commit details
    Browse the repository at this point in the history